HDMI and I2S are not the same thing and, if I understand correctly, are not compatible even though both use a "HDMI cable" (with some I2S using RJ45).

The BDA-3 does have 2 channel HDMI capability, but the Holo and the Denafrips are I2S and would not work with the Oppo as a transport via its HDMI output, but of course would work as a transport for all via Coax S/PDIF..
